Workstation

To ensure that the entire salon program aligns with my design concept, I've created a set of mobile and flexible workstations. These designs not only cater to the dimensions of hairdressers and clients but also encourage people to move around and interact with one another, or, in some cases, provide the option to maintain personal space, enabling them to freely explore and engage in various activities.
